Weetbix Deluxe (Caramel Slice) |
|
 |
Prep Time: 20 Minutes Cook Time: 20 Minutes |
Ready In: 40 Minutes Servings: 10 |
|
This is my paternal grandmother's recipe for caramel slice. It is quite sweet, so you might want to skip the chocolate icing. I've done this many times and it still tastes great. Ingredients:
3 weet-bix, crushed |
1 cup plain flour |
1 cup coconut |
3/4 cup sugar |
1 teaspoon baking powder |
4 ounces butter |
0.5 (395 g) can condensed milk |
1 tablespoon butter |
1 1/2 tablespoons golden syrup |
chocolate icing |
1 1/4 cups icing sugar |
2 tablespoons butter |
2 tablespoons cocoa |
1 tablespoon hot water |
Directions:
1. Place all dry ingredients in a bowl. 2. Mix 4 ounces of melted butter and press into a lamington tray. 3. Cook in an oven at 325F for 15 minutes. 4. Stir condensed milk, 1 tbsp butter and golden syrup together in a pot until blended. 5. Pour onto cooked base and return to the oven for 5 minutes. 6. NB: Make sure this is no longer than 5 minutes otherwise the caramel will go bubbly and ruin the slice. If you think it needs longer watch it very carefully. 7. Chocolate icing. 8. Mix all ingredients together in a bowl. 9. Spread icing mixture on the slice while it is still warm. 10. When cool put it in the fridge to set. |
